Have had this ever since getting sick for years to varying degrees. The right eye seems to be bigger or bulging and that pupil is more dilated.

Have not been able to get a clear answer as to what this is. Just want to put a name to it. Don't know if it's Adie's because what I've read about Adie's doesn't say anything about the eye itself bulging more or being being bigger, just the pupil being more dilated.

I think with Horner's the effected pupil is smaller so that's not it. The only answer's I've ever gotten were from an eye doctor at the very beginning telling me it is neurological but wouldn't give me anymore info and basicly kicked me out.

My current Lyme doc said something about it possibly being caused by metals but what I want is a name for the condition. Anyone have this exact presentation that actually was given a name for it?
